Chennai: Indian will be operating a direct flight between Chennai to Dubai daily from June 1, an official release said on Wednesday.
The flight IC 905 will be leaving Chennai at 2000 hours and arrive at Dubai at 2230 hours (Local time). The flight IC 906 will leave Dubai at 1345 hours (local time) and arrive at Chennai at 1900 hours, it said.
On the Kozhikode-Dubai sector, Indian will operate a daily flight, instead of twice-a-week schedule. The flight IC 538 will leave Kozhikode at 1015 hours and arrive at Dubai at 1245 hours (local time) while IC 537 will leave Dubai at 0200 hours (local time) and reach Kozhikode at 0700 hours. The release said the airline would provide a new link on every Wednesday between Thiruvananthapuram and Kuwait. The flight IC 589 will leave Thiruvananthapuram at 1345 hours and arrive at Kuwait, via Sharjah at 1805 (local time) while IC 590 will leave Kuwait every Thursday at 0500 hours (local time and arrive at Thiruvananthapuram, via Sharjah at 1000 hours.
